dc.description.abstract | THE PROBLEM - 51.7 million intubations performed annually in the US. - 10.3% experience complications. - 5.3 million complications need to be addressed. We aim to ease the process of intubation and improve patient outcomes by reducing the diameter of the ETT to improve visibility.
